Abstract :
Crystal structures of tetraiodo-p-benzoquinone (iodanil) up to 10.3 GPa were measured by x-ray powder diffraction experiments at room temperature to investigate the mechanism of pressure-induced metallization of iodanil. Diffraction patterns analyzed by the Rietveld method were well explained with the space group P21/c. A 26 % compression in volume at 10.3 GPa and remarkable decreases in I-I distances between the adjacent molecules suggest a preliminary process for the metallization.
